Blueberry Lemon Bread
Ingredients
  • 1 cup white sugar
  • 1/3 cup melted butter
  • 2 large eggs
  • 3 tablespoons lemon juice
  • 1 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 cup milk
  • 1 cup fresh or frozen blueberries
  • 1/2 cup chopped walnuts
  • 2 tablespoons grated lemon zest
  • 1/4 cup white sugar
  • 2 tablespoons lemon juice
Instructions
1
Preheat your oven to 350 degrees Fahrenheit, or 175 degrees Celsius.
2
To prepare the loaf pan, lightly coat it with a thin layer of cooking spray or oil.
3
In a large mixing bowl, combine and whisk together sugar, butter, eggs, and lemon juice until well blended.
4
In a separate bowl, whisk together flour, baking powder, and salt. Gradually add the dry ingredients to the egg mixture in an alternating manner with milk, stirring until just combined.
5
Gently fold in blueberries, nuts, and lemon zest into the batter to distribute evenly.
6
Pour the prepared batter into the lightly greased loaf pan.
7
Bake the bread in a preheated oven for 60 to 70 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center of the loaf comes out clean.
8
Allow the bread to cool in the pan for 10 minutes before transferring it to a wire rack.
9
In a small bowl, whisk together sugar and lemon juice until smooth.
10
Drizzle the cooled bread with the prepared glaze topping.
11
Continue to cool the bread on a wire rack until fully cooled.
